    Just adding another datapoint for the folks looking for feedback on PowerNotebooks.com - I'll just copypasta my resellerratings review here:

    As for the machines themselves, I couldn't be happier. These are my third and fourth Sager notebooks in the past 10 years. What they lack in finesse of in terms of construction and finish, they more than make up for in feature set and performance. The keyboards aren't the best in the world, but aside from Apple or Lenovo, I've not seen too many notebook keyboards that I really liked. The only change I made was to swap the stock Seagate 500GB drives with Crucial M4 512GB SSD's. I'm quite satisfied with this upgrade.
